ROM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2023 in Review

40 of the 6,383 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ProShares Ultra Technology (ROM) for Q2 2023, worth a combined $38.5M — down 9.8% from $42.7M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 12 funds opened new ROM positions and 5 closed out — a net gain of 7 holders — while 3 added to existing stakes and 16 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Goldman Sachs, opening a new position worth an estimated $477K. The largest seller was Howard Capital Management, cutting an estimated $3.8M.
